In this video, I’m going to tell you how to look younger naturally. The secret to younger-looking skin is NOT wearing sunblock every single day!


UV rays make up only about 3% of the sun's wavelengths. Sixty percent of sunlight is infrared light, which has numerous health benefits. Sunblock typically only blocks UVB rays, which are essential for making vitamin D. It doesn't block the UVA rays, which are typically deemed harmful.


Even UVA rays have health benefits! They can increase nitric oxide, which increases blood flow and circulation to the skin.


Skin cancer is often a serious concern when being exposed to the sun. Although we’ve been decreasing sun exposure, melanomas have increased significantly. Interestingly enough, melanomas usually occur in areas that are not exposed to the sun. So, is it the sun that’s causing melanomas?


If you’re using a moisturizer for younger-looking skin, check the ingredients! Many creams that claim to make you look younger are full of chemicals and actually have the opposite effect.


Synthetic antioxidants, sugar, and junk food will age the skin quickly. Overwashing your face can also cause problems. Antibiotics and things that act like antibiotics, such as birth control pills, antacids, steroids, and statins, can wreak havoc on your skin.


Oxytocin is a hormone that can increase stem cells for your skin. It has potent regenerative properties that also help with bonding and make people feel more social and calm. The microbe L. Reuteri can significantly increase oxytocin.


Many people do not have L. Reuteri in their microbiome. When you destroy the microbiome, certain microbes never come back!


Cold immersion, exercise, and facial exercises can also help you look younger.
